SALT LAKE CITY — The Red Rocks had 12 student-athletes earn WCGA Academic Honors on Monday morning for their efforts in the classroom during the 2024-25 season.
Utah Gymnastics as a team earned a cumulative grade-point average of 3.6825, with 75% of the team earning an individual GPA of 3.500 or higher.
As such,
Elizabeth Gantner,
Jaylene Gilstrap,
Ashley Glynn,
Sarah Krump,
Grace McCallum,
Amelie Morgan,
Ana Padurariu,
Clara Raposo,
Jaedyn Rucker,
Makenna Smith,
Camie Winger, and
Ella Zirbes were all recognized by the WCGAÂ as Scholastic All-America Award winners for their commitment to their studies last season.
Gantner, McCallum, Padurariu, Raposo, and Zirbes all earned perfect GPA scores of 4.0.
The Red Rocks are in the process of preparing for the 2026 season after making their 49
th straight Nationals appearance and fifth straight Final Four appearance in 2025.
